Elisabeth Sparkle (Demi Moore)

Elisabeth is a once-admired aerobics star facing the harsh realities of aging and career loss. Her initial confidence crumbles as she battles insecurity and seeks validation through the transformation into Sue. Her character embodies the struggles many face in the entertainment industry regarding self-image and relevance.

👩‍🎤 Star 📉 Insecurity 🎭 Transformation

Sue (Margaret Qualley)

Sue represents the youthful alter ego of Elisabeth, characterized by beauty, confidence, and the allure of fame. However, her dependence on the Stabilizer serum illustrates the precariousness of her existence and the moral implications behind her creation. As she revels in her newfound adoration, she becomes increasingly consumed by the need to maintain that façade.

Major Themes – The Substance (2024)
Explore the central themes of The Substance (2024), from psychological, social, and emotional dimensions to philosophical messages. Understand what the film is really saying beneath the surface.

🌟 Youth

Youth is a central theme, as Elisabeth's desperate attempts to reclaim her lost vitality lead to severe consequences. The transformation into Sue illustrates the lengths to which one can go for beauty and approval, but also highlights the emptiness of such pursuits. As both characters grapple with the implications of their altered existences, the narrative critiques societal pressures surrounding aging.

⚖️ Duality

The concept of duality is explored through the relationship between Elisabeth and Sue, representing contrasting aspects of identity and self-perception. Their interplay raises questions about self-worth and the price of fame, revealing the darker side of human desires and the consequences of losing one's authentic self.

💔 Despair

Despair permeates the film, as Elisabeth's struggle with inadequacy drives her to unhealthy coping mechanisms. This theme is further explored through Sue's dependence on the Stabilizer serum, creating a poignant commentary on addiction and the damaging effects of societal expectations on mental health.
